Why Use Pinterest Ads?

1. High Purchase Intent

Unlike social media platforms where users scroll passively, Pinterest users actively search for products, services, and ideas. This means they have a much higher intent to purchase compared to users on Facebook or Instagram.

2. Lower Competition

Since Pinterest Ads are still an untapped resource for many businesses, advertising costs remain lower compared to Google and Facebook Ads. This makes it an excellent ROI-driven marketing platform.

3. Long-Term Traffic

Pinterest Pins can rank for months and even years, unlike Facebook and Instagram ads that disappear once you stop paying. This means your promoted content can continue to drive traffic even after the ad campaign ends.

Step 5: Choose the Right Ad Format

Pinterest offers multiple ad formats based on your campaign goals:

  1. Promoted Pins – Boosts a regular pin to appear in search results
  2. Promoted Video Pins – Ideal for storytelling through short clips
  3. Shopping Ads – Direct users to e-commerce stores
  4. Carousel Ads – Multiple images in one ad
  5. Collections Ads – Showcases a combination of products
